A Blood Stained Love Affair is one of those intriguing entries from the 1970s that encapsulates the complexities of forbidden love intertwined with the backdrop of Japan's nightlife. The pacing has a languid quality, which contrasts sharply with the tension bubbling under the surface, especially as Emika navigates her complicated family ties and Riki's ambitions. The performances have a raw intensity, particularly Riki's yearning and Emika's innocence, which creates a palpable atmosphere of longing and danger. There are practical effects that, while not groundbreaking, add an edge to the narrative's darker moments, making it feel gritty and real. It's certainly a film that lingers in your mind after the credits roll, perhaps not overly polished, but definitely striking in its own way.
